Volvo Construction Equipment offers powerful API solutions that give customers direct access to high-quality machine data for use within their own digital systems. Whether you need standardized telematics or machine-specific deep data, consolidated information about your fleet will help you identify the actions needed to enhance the productivity and efficiency of your entire operation.
| Feature / Need | AEMP 2.0 | Extended Asset API |
| Primary Purpose | Standardized, ISO15143-3 telematics for mixed fleets |
Extended with more Volvo-specific machine insights (diesel + electric) |
| Best For | Customers needing basic telematics in a common format across multiple OEMs | Customers needing richer data fields, electric machine insights, or custom integrations |
| Fleet Type | Ideal for mixed fleets using third-party systems | Ideal for Volvo-heavy fleets, electric fleets, or custom-built solutions |
| Data Depth | Essential fields: location, hours, utilization, fuel use, ISO standard fault codes. | Extended fields: battery status, charging, energy consumption, fault codes (including from older generation machines). |
| Electric Machine Support | Limited | Full support (battery, charging, energy data) |
| Diagnostic Data | Basic ISO 15143-3 standard | Includes Volvo fault/error codes and advanced diagnostics |
| Format | ISO-defined structure | Flexible JSON schema |
| Call Rate | Standard | Higher limits for near real-time integrations |
| Customization | Limited; fixed ISO standard | Highly flexible; supports tailored data consumption |
| Future-readiness | Stable baseline | Built to expand with new technologies and data schemas |
| Typical Use Case | Third-party fleet platforms | In-house systems, advanced analytics, predictive maintenance |
A rental business uses a commercial fleet management system to monitor all equipment, regardless of manufacturer. They need location, hours and utilization at a standard format.
AEMP 2.0 is the optimal fit.
A construction firm focuses on fuel trends across their fleet supplied by a mix of OEMs. Only ISO fields are needed.
AEMP 2.0 provides everything required.
A company only uses basic KPIs for dashboards (run hours, idle time, location).
AEMP 2.0 is straightforward, consistent and easy to integrate.
A municipality is transitioning to electric compact equipment and needs charging cycles, energy consumption and battery status to optimize work planning.
Extended Asset API is essential.
A business has an in-house platform that uses machine signals to automate billing, maintenance scheduling and utilization alerts. They need deeper machine data and higher call limits.
Extended Asset API gives them the flexibility and detail required.
An industrial contractor wants fault codes, starter battery voltage and other diagnostic parameters to anticipate downtime.
Extended Asset API provides these richer data fields.
A quarry operator currently uses diesel machines but has plans to add electric haulers. They want a single API approach that will scale with future assets.
Extended Asset API is the more future-proof option.
